Market Drivers
Several factors are driving the growth of the Global Agricultural Lubricants Market:
- Mechanization in Agriculture: The increasing use of automated machinery for planting, harvesting, and irrigation is one of the primary drivers of the agricultural lubricants market, as these machines require high-performance lubricants to maintain efficiency and reduce wear.
- Rising Demand for High-Performance Equipment: As agricultural machinery becomes more advanced, the need for specialized lubricants that can withstand high temperatures, pressure, and load is growing, boosting the demand for premium lubricants.
- Growing Demand for Sustainable Solutions: With increasing environmental concerns and regulatory requirements, there is a significant push toward biodegradable, non-toxic lubricants that minimize environmental impact and comply with sustainability goals.
- Global Population Growth: As the global population continues to increase, the demand for food production is also rising. This drives the need for more efficient farming operations, which in turn increases the demand for reliable, high-quality lubricants.
Market Restraints
Despite its growth potential, the Global Agricultural Lubricants Market faces several challenges:
- High Cost of Advanced Lubricants: High-performance, specialized lubricants, particularly those with environmentally friendly formulations, often come with higher costs, which can be a barrier for farmers, especially in developing regions with limited access to such products.
- Fluctuating Raw Material Prices: The prices of raw materials used in the production of lubricants, such as base oils and additives, can fluctuate, leading to price instability in the lubricants market.
- Lack of Awareness in Emerging Markets: In emerging economies, the awareness of the benefits of high-quality lubricants for agricultural equipment is still relatively low, which may hinder the widespread adoption of advanced lubricants in these regions.
- Competition from Alternative Products: The market faces competition from alternative solutions such as plant-based oils and greases, which are gaining popularity due to their sustainability and natural composition, posing a challenge for traditional lubricant manufacturers.

Regional Analysis
The Global Agricultural Lubricants Market exhibits regional variations in demand and adoption rates:
- North America: North America holds a significant market share, driven by advanced farming techniques, high mechanization levels, and a focus on sustainability in agricultural practices.
- Europe: Europe is a mature market with stringent environmental regulations pushing the demand for biodegradable and eco-friendly lubricants. The region also has a strong agricultural sector, particularly in countries like Germany and France.
- Asia Pacific: The Asia Pacific market is witnessing rapid growth due to increased mechanization in countries like China and India, where agriculture is a dominant sector. As these regions modernize their farming practices, the demand for high-quality agricultural lubricants is expected to rise.
- Latin America: Latin America is experiencing gradual growth in the agricultural lubricants market, driven by the expansion of large-scale commercial farming operations and the need for efficient machinery.
- Middle East & Africa: The Middle East & Africa region presents growth opportunities as agriculture becomes more mechanized, particularly in countries with arid climates where efficient irrigation and farming equipment are essential.

Segmentation
The Global Agricultural Lubricants Market can be segmented based on various factors, including:
- By Product Type: Engine Oils, Hydraulic Fluids, Gear Oils, Greases, and Transmission Fluids.
- By Application: Tractors, Harvesters, Irrigation Systems, Plows, and Other Farm Equipment.
- By End-User: Small-Scale Farms, Large-Scale Farms, and Commercial Agricultural Enterprises.
Category-wise Insights
Each category of agricultural lubricants offers distinct benefits based on machinery needs:
- Engine Oils: Essential for the lubrication of engines in agricultural machinery, offering protection against wear, corrosion, and heat.
- Hydraulic Fluids: Used in hydraulic systems to ensure smooth operation and efficient power transmission, crucial for equipment like harvesters and plows.
- Greases: Used for high-pressure applications, greases provide extended lubrication for parts under extreme pressure and friction.
- Gear Oils: Designed for the lubrication of gears in agricultural equipment, gear oils help minimize wear and improve performance.
